Ingredients to make The recipe :

To prepare the Simple Peach Cobbler Made with Cake Mix, you will need the following ingredients:

  • Peaches: Fresh or canned peaches are the star of this recipe. If using fresh peaches, about 4-5 medium-sized ones will yield the right amount, while canned peaches (about two 15-ounce cans) can also be used for convenience. Peaches bring a sweet and slightly tangy flavor to the dish, making them the ideal fruit for cobbler.
  • Cake Mix: A standard box of yellow cake mix or white cake mix, typically around 15.25 ounces, serves as the base for the cobbler. The cake mix provides a sweet, fluffy texture that contrasts beautifully with the juicy peaches. It simplifies the baking process while ensuring a moist and flavorful topping.
  • Butter: You will need ½ cup (one stick) of unsalted butter. Melted butter adds richness and moisture to the cobbler, creating a golden crust. Its flavor enhances the overall taste, making each bite indulgent.
  • Brown Sugar: About ½ cup of packed brown sugar will enhance the caramelization of the peaches during baking. This ingredient contributes a deeper, richer sweetness compared to regular granulated sugar, making it essential for achieving the perfect flavor balance in your cobbler.
  • Cinnamon: A teaspoon of ground cinnamon adds warmth and spice to the dish, elevating the flavor profile. This aromatic spice complements the sweetness of the peaches and the richness of the cake mix beautifully.
  • Water: A small amount of water (about 1 cup) is needed to help create a syrupy consistency with the peaches. This liquid will blend with the juices released from the fruit during baking, resulting in a luscious filling.

How to Make Simple Peach Cobbler Made with Cake Mix?

Follow these detailed steps to create the Simple Peach Cobbler Made with Cake Mix:

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ures that your cobbler will bake evenly and achieve a golden-brown crust.
  2. Prepare your baking dish. Use a 9×13 inch baking dish, greasing it lightly with cooking spray or butter to prevent sticking. This step is crucial for easy removal once the cobbler is baked.
  3. If using fresh peaches, wash, peel, and slice them into thin wedges. If using canned peaches, drain the syrup, reserving about 1/4 cup for later use. Arrange the peaches evenly in the bottom of the prepared baking dish.
  4. In a mixing bowl, combine the peaches with ½ cup of packed brown sugar and a teaspoon of ground cinnamon. Stir gently to coat the peaches and allow them to sit for about 10 minutes. This will draw out the natural juices, creating a flavorful base.
  5. While the peaches are resting, melt ½ cup of unsalted butter in a microwave-safe bowl or on the stovetop. Once melted, set it aside to cool slightly.
  6. In another bowl, prepare the cake mix. Pour the dry cake mix over the peaches, spreading it evenly across the top. Do not mix; this layering is important for the cobbler’s texture.
  7. Carefully drizzle the melted butter over the cake mix, ensuring that you cover as much surface area as possible. This will help the topping bake into a golden crust.
  8. Next, pour about 1 cup of water over the entire dish. Again, do not mix. The water will seep through the cake mix and help create a moist, cake-like layer on top of the peaches.
  9. For an added touch of sweetness, sprinkle a little extra brown sugar and cinnamon over the top of the cake mix. This will create a beautifully caramelized crust.
  10.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 45-50 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the cake mix comes out clean. The bubbling juices should be visible around the edges.
  11. Once baked, remove the cobbler from the oven and allow it to cool for about 10-15 minutes before serving. This resting time allows the juices to thicken slightly.
  12. Serve warm, either on its own or with a scoop of your favorite ice cream. The contrast of warm cobbler with cold ice cream is simply divine!

Tips for Variations:

To elevate your Simple Peach Cobbler Made with Cake Mix, consider these creative variations:

  • For a mixed fruit cobbler, substitute half of the peaches with other fruits such as blueberries, raspberries, or cherries. This adds a burst of flavor and color, making the dish even more visually appealing.
  • Incorporate nuts into your cobbler by adding chopped pecans or walnuts on top of the cake mix before baking. The nuts will provide a delightful crunch that contrasts with the soft peaches.
  • For a bit of tanginess, mix in some lemon juice or zest with the peaches. This brightens up the flavor profile and adds a refreshing note that complements the sweetness of the cobbler.
  • If you enjoy spices, consider adding a pinch of nutmeg or ginger alongside the cinnamon. These spices add depth and warmth, enhancing the overall flavor experience.
  • For a more decadent version, layer in some cream cheese before adding the cake mix. This addition will create a rich, creamy layer that pairs beautifully with the peaches.
  • Try adding a splash of almond extract to the melted butter for a unique flavor twist that complements the sweetness of the peaches remarkably well.

FAQ:

How do I store leftovers?

To store leftovers of your Simple Peach Cobbler Made with Cake Mix, allow it to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. Store in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Reheat in the microwave or oven to enjoy warm.

Can I freeze this recipe?

Yes, you can freeze the Simple Peach Cobbler Made with Cake Mix. Ensure it cools completely, then w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il. Freeze for up to 3 months. To serve, th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at before enjoying.

Can I use frozen peaches for this recipe?

Absolutely! Frozen peaches can be used in the Simple Peach Cobbler Made with Cake Mix. Just ensure they are thawed and drained of excess moisture before using them to prevent a soggy cobbler.

How do I know when my cobbler is done baking?

Your cobbler is done when the top is gol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the cake mix comes out clean. You should also see bubbling around the edges, indicating that the juices are cooking properly.

Can I make this recipe 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the Simple Peach Cobbler Made with Cake Mix ahead of time. You can assemble it and store it in the refrigerator until you’re ready to bake. Just add a few extra minutes to the baking time if it’s cold from the fridge.
